Description :
GStreamer is a streaming media framework, based on graphs of filters which
operate on media data. Applications using this library can do anything
from real-time sound processing to playing videos, and just about anything
else media-related. Its plugin-based architecture means that new data
types or processing capabilities can be added simply by installing new
plugins.
GStreamer Good Plugins is a collection of well-supported plugins of
good quality and under the LGPL license.
